WebAug 11, 2024 · Pathway enrichment analysis (PEA) is a computational biology method that identifies biological functions that are overrepresented in a group of genes more than would be expected by chance and ranks these functions by relevance. Point-Evidence-Analysis Some jurisdictions refer to paragraphing in schools as having the P-E-E or P-E-A structure. These refer to Point-Evidence-Explanation or Point-Evidence-Analysis. What is pea in English literature? PEA stands for Point, Evidence and Analysis. This is a particularly good method to employ ... WebPEA is an integrative method of existential analysis that aims to access, activate, and restructure the core existential capabilities of the human person. PEA is a bottom-up processing method that moves from the richness of concreteness toward higher levels of personal integration and expression.
